On the completeness of a family of conditional distributions

B. R. Bhat and Somnath Datta

Statistics & Probability Letters, 1992, vol. 15, issue 1, 27-30

Abstract: In this note, we establish the statistical completeness of a family of conditional distributions of a statistic given another statistic where the first statistic is complete and the second statistic is sufficient for some parametric family of distributions. This resulting method enables us to determine easily the completeness of many families of distributions some of which are well known, and some not so well known. We illustrate our method with a number of examples.
